You should delete the file definition and add it back into the the data dictionary.
1. If you added a new field, generated apps are not affected. You do not even need to recompile anything.
2. If you changed a field (like its size), you have to remove it from your apps, reselect it, and recompile.
3. If you deleted a field, you have to remove it from your apps and recompile.
When removing the field from an app, remember that it might be used in many ways: sequencing, joining, calcs, selections, external object parms, Smartlink parameters, etc.
Have a hotline question of your own? Send an e-mail to support@mrc-productivity.com and let our product specialists help you!